Huang Bo (Chinese: 黄渤; pinyin: Huáng Bó; born August 26, 1974) is a Chinese actor, film director, singer and the current vice-chairman of China Film Association. He is the winner of multiple Chinese film awards, and ranked 34th on Forbes China Celebrity 100 list in 2013, 62nd in 2014, 22nd in 2015, 30th in 2017, 2nd in 2019, 52nd in 2020.

Box office. $76.4 million [2] Across the Furious Sea ( Chinese: 涉过愤怒的海) is a 2023 Chinese crime thriller drama film directed and co-written by Cao Baoping, and starring Huang Bo and Zhou Xun. The film was adapted from the novel by Lao Huang of the same name published in Fiction Monthly. [3]

Some pundits dubbed 2013 ‘The Year of Huang Bo’ for his multiple prominent film appearances, including a starring role in Stephen Chow’s Journey to the West. 5. He's Funny. Huang is known primarily for his down-to-earth comedic talent as well as his ability to pull in ticket sales in “the age of xiaoxianrou.”
